Abstract

The Ngrowo-Ngasinan sub-watershed is a part of Brantas Watershed which has an important role for the aquatic ecosystems in the Brantas watershed. Land cover changes in this sub-watershed can be identified by utilizing remote sensing technology. The use of remote sensing technology by applying Landsat 8 image data can be done by classifying several classes of land cover in the study area. Land cover affected the flow rate of a watershed because of its association with several problems due to the conversion of land. Land cover which influences the watershed ecosystems is forest. In addition to land cover, regional rainfall also affects the flow rate (runoff) in the area
